= (operatore di assegnazione) (Transact-SQL)
Si applica a:SQL Server database SQL di Azure Istanza gestita di SQL di Azure Azure Synapse Analytics AnalyticsPlatform System (PDW)SQL analytics endpoint in Microsoft FabricWarehouse in Microsoft Fabric
Il segno di uguale (=) è l'unico operatore di assegnazione supportato in Transact-SQL. Nell'esempio seguente viene creata la variabile @MyCounter
e quindi viene utilizzato l'operatore di assegnazione per impostare @MyCounter
su un valore restituito da un'espressione.
DECLARE @MyCounter INT;
SET @MyCounter = 1;
È inoltre possibile utilizzare l'operatore di assegnazione per stabilire una relazione tra l'intestazione di una colonna e l'espressione che definisce i valori di tale colonna. Nell'esempio seguente vengono visualizzate le intestazioni di colonna FirstColumnHeading
e SecondColumnHeading
. Nell'intestazione di colonna xyz
viene visualizzata la stringa FirstColumnHeading
per tutte le righe e nell'intestazione di colonna Product
vengono elencati gli ID di tutti i prodotti della tabella SecondColumnHeading
.
-- Uses AdventureWorks
SELECT FirstColumnHeading = 'xyz',
SecondColumnHeading = ProductID
FROM Production.Product;
GO
Vedi anche
Operatori (Transact-SQL)
Operatori composti (Transact-SQL)
Espressioni (Transact-SQL)
Commenti e suggerimenti
https://aka.ms/ContentUserFeedback.
Presto disponibile: Nel corso del 2024 verranno gradualmente disattivati i problemi di GitHub come meccanismo di feedback per il contenuto e ciò verrà sostituito con un nuovo sistema di feedback. Per altre informazioni, vedereInvia e visualizza il feedback per